THE HEALTHY FILLING BREAKFAST/SNACK TO SATISFY A SWEETOOTH
You will need...
-1 cup of old fashioned oats
-1/2 cup of soymilk(if you drink cowmilk, then you can use that)
-1 large ripe banana
-raisans(optional, use to your liking)
-nuts(most nuts work, if you have nut allergies you can skip this one)
1. Pour the milk into a pot and add the oats, cook on small setting for about 5 mins.
2. Mash banana with fork on plate.
3. Pour cooked oats on plate and mix with the banana.
4. Add nuts and raisans.
5. Stir and enjoy!

L'oreal Telescopic Explosion Mascara Review
This mascara appealed to me because it is known to be a dupe for Givenchy phenomen' eyes mascara. The wand is different from your usual mascara and according to L'oreal this mascara is for people who want lots of length. It fans out, extends and seperates lashes. While this wand is very interesting and makes it easier to get lashes in the inner corners of the eye, it has a clumping problem. No matter if you comb your lashes out afterwards, your lashes will be glued together. And after a while, the mascara starts to fall off and your left with a bunch of black flakes under your eyes. Overall, I do not recommend this mascara, and i will not be repurchusing it.

L'oreal Hip high intensity pigments Jelly Balm Review



The L'oreal Hip jelly balms are fabulous. About a week ago, I purchused "Plush" at a Walgreens and now I can't stop using it! The L'oreal Hip Jelly Balms are considered a dupe for MAC's Tendertones(limited edition). Both of these are very smooth, moisturizing and have a light scent and taste to them, however the MAC Tendertones(not sold anymore) have no color to them. "Plush" by L'oreal is a light baby-pink. It smells like cotton candy and caramel and has this light caramel taste to it. I love how it glides on smoothly and moisturizes. There is no glitter in it, which I love because I don't like the griddy feeling of glitter or having the gloss wear off and just having glitter stuck to your lips. I will definitly be repurchusing this product and I am going to get all 8 colors! :P Here are some pictures...

L'oreal go 360 Clean deep facial cleanser/cream cleanser-REVIEW




When I first saw this in an issue of "Seventeen" magazine, I knew I had to have it, and the next day I went out and got the green kind. At first I loved it and used it every day twice(morning and afternoon), but then gradually I stopped using it because my skin seemed to be getting dryer and dryer. I absolutely love how the product lathers and I really enjoy the scrublet. But as mentioned, it really dried my skin out to the point where I had to moisturize my face more than usual. My skin is pretty normal. I break out hardly ever, and if I do the it's just a small pimple. I do however recommend the green cleanser for people with oilyer skin, but remember to always moisturize afterwards!
Now, you might wounder what I do use it for, of course I wouldn't throw it out, so i decided to use the green cleanser to clean my make-up brushes. It lathers nicely and gets all the make-up out!
I recently purchused the pink one(cream cleanser) but I haven't started using it yet. However, when I do, I will let you guys know;)
